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 81445424228 51838512759 5060878943
02487477406 439439
02487477406 439439
0407310977 290852378 1471
All about undefined
Interested in learning more?
02487477406 439439
0407310977 290852378 1471
See more
957362 06132
10235 3235 8601 5588304292
See more
73304431392 258276
65597937625 9028 41725 50
See more